H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ES COMMITTEE ON OVERSIGHT REP. STEVEN JOHNSON CHAIR COMMITTEE MEETING MINUTES Thursday, May 19, 2022 10:30 AM Room 326, House Office Building The House Committee on Oversight was called to order by Chair Steven Johnson. The Chair requested attendance be called: Present: Reps. Steven Johnson, Outman, Hoitenga, Reilly, Yaroch, O'Malley, Brixie, LaGrand, Young. Absent: None. Excused: None. The Chair laid before the committee the Discussion with the Michigan Department of Health and Human Services on the Adult Protective Services Audit by the Auditor General. Terrence Beurer, Cynthia Farrell, Tim Click, and Marie Shipp, representing the Michigan Department of Health and Human Services, testified in regard to the Adult Protective Services Audit by the Auditor General. Questions and discussion followed. Representative Yaroch moved to adopt the meeting minutes from May 5, 2022. There being no objection, the motion prevailed by unanimous consent. The Chair laid HB 6062 before the committee: HB 6062 (Rep. Coleman) A bill to set forth the methods for local governments and other governmental entities to provide certain public notices; to prescribe the powers and duties of certain public entities; and to prescribe the duties of certain private entities. Representative Coleman testified in support of HB 6062. Questions and discussion followed. Lisa McGraw, representing the Michigan Press Association, testified in opposition to HB 6062. Questions and discussion followed. Bradley Thompson, representing the Detroit Legal News, testified in opposition to HB 6062. Questions and discussion followed. Judy Allen, representing the Michigan Township Association, and Deena Bosworth, representing the Michigan Association of Counties, testified in support of HB 6062. The following people submitted a card in support of HB 6062, but did not wish to speak: Mike Spence, representing the Southeast Michigan Council of Governments. Jennifer Rigterink, representing the Michigan Municipal League. The following people submitted a card in opposition to HB 6062, but did not wish to speak: Ban Ibrahim, representing the Detroit Legal News. Eric Hamp, representing the Houghton Lake Resorter. Ray McGrew, representing the Ludington Daily News, Oceana's Herald Journal, White Lake Beacon, Iosco County News, and the Oscoda Press. John T. Elchert, representing the Leelanau Enterprise. Jeremy McBain, representing Hearst Midwest and Texas Communities. James Brown, representing the Yale Expositor. Justin Hinkley, representing The Alpena News. Fred, representing J-Ad Graphics. Elaine Myers, representing C & G Newspapers. Tom Campbell, representing The Argus Press. Sean Cotton and Anne Gryzenia, representing Grosse Pointe News. Paul Heidbreder, representing the Traverse City Record Eagle. Jordan Wilcox, representing Wilcox Newspapers. Bruce Rolfe, representing the Climax Crescent Newspaper. There being no further business before the committee, Chair Steven Johnson adjourned the meeting at 11:53 AM. Representative Steven Johnson, Chair Edward Sleeper Committee Clerk esleeper@house.mi.gov
